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Bath to Charlotte is to fly which costs $370 - $1,500 and takes 15h 9m.
The fastest way to get from Bath to Charlotte is to train and fly which takes 13h 30m and costs $650 - $1,900.
The distance between Bath and Charlotte is 3941 miles.
It takes approximately 15h 9m to get from Bath to Charlotte, including transfers.
Charlotte is 5h behind Bath. It is currently 7:33 PM in Bath and 2:33 PM in Charlotte.
